Glycosides are formed when the hydroxyl group on the anomeric carbon of a sugar and the hydroxyl group of another molecule condense to form an acetal or ketal linkage fig. Acetal linkage between the aglycon and glycone more unstable than that between two individual sugars within the molecule. If the sugar unit is some di or tri saccharide, specific enzymes are used to effect only partial hydrolysis of the glycoside so as to identify the oligosaccharide. Themajor problem confounding such synthesis is the requirement that the cc bond being formed results in a quaternary c atom. All glycosides are hydrolysable by acids except cglycosides. A glycoside is an organic compound, usually of plant origin, and comprising a sugar portion linked to a nonsugar moiety in a particular manner. The glycosides are chemically susceptible to acid conditions, and only in some cases to basic conditions.
